Output 93a594f2552168cf16cf1c339bfb2441ffa19c72e661b054cfa1a4230e4365e7:42

value
569822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800f427728e9be2b0f57c5134a75897c2c18ed06 OP_EQUAL
address
3DN8hMb6KKpb9VL21ud5hSSHK84Rhofgao
transaction
93a594f2552168cf16cf1c339bfb2441ffa19c72e661b054cfa1a4230e4365e7